The Jazz Band needs to raise at least $600 to travel to an upcoming competition. The members of the band have already raised $35
0. If they sell calendars for $8 each how many calendars would they need to sell to exceed their goal?
2 answers:
Answer: At least 32 calendars.
Step-by-step explanation:
Since they already have $350 out of the $600, they only need to raise $250 more (600-350).
Each calendar is $8
To find how many calendars are needed to raise $250, divide it by $8 (250/8=31.25)
Since you cannot sell .25 of a calendar it would round up to be 32.

Step-by-step explanation:
Make an inequality
Let x represent calendars
8x+350 > 600
Solve, first by subtract 350 from both sides
8x>250
Divide by 8 on both sides
x> 31.25
They must sell at least 32 calendars, because if they only sold 31, they would not meet their goal.
